    Colombia vs England | Prediction, Betting Tips & Odds

    Colombia do not have a great tradition at the World Cup and many people are surprised to hear they are appearing in only their sixth World Cup finals.  A win in this game against England would see them equal their best ever performance by reaching the quarter-final. England have been poor at recent major tournaments but seem to be playing with more confidence under Gareth Southgate.  It may not be the most talented England squad we have seen at a tournament but they appear to be enjoying their football in Russia.

    Match Preview

    Colombia are sweating on the fitness of James Rodriguez ahead of this game.  The Bayern Munich star limped off in the win over Senegal and there are huge doubts over his participation in this match.  Losing Rodriguez would be a massive blow to Colombia and would leave them short of creativity. England have no such worries and they rested several of their first team players in their final group game.  Harry Kane has been firing on all cylinders in Russia and will be feeling confident of adding to his 5 goals from the group stages.

    Colombia

    Colombia suffered an early setback when they lost 2-1 to Japan in their opening game.  Going down to 10 men was the major factor behind the defeat and they bounced back to produce an excellent performance against Poland and win 3-0.  This left them a final game against Senegal and despite not playing well, Colombia won 1-0 to progress to the Round of 16.

    England

    England started well against Tunisia but allowed them back into the game and a last minute goal from Harry Kane was needed to win the match 2-1.  There were no such problems against a shambolic Panama team who defended badly and England took full advantage to win 6-1.  England were afforded the luxury of resting players for the final match and lost a bit of momentum, going down 1-0 to Belgium.

    Colombia vs England Head to Head

    Colombia have played England 5 times in their history and are yet to win a game.  The last time they met was in 2005 and England won the friendly match 3-2.  In the 1998 World Cup, England won 2-0 and the best Colombia have done is two draws, in 1988 and 1995.
